Transaction 2d64ed7175d7f90f42a4a22ec6d466ad8454da895a1932cbebbbd31c8bd08b79
1 Input
2 Outputs
- 2d64ed7175d7f90f42a4a22ec6d466ad8454da895a1932cbebbbd31c8bd08b79:0
- 2d64ed7175d7f90f42a4a22ec6d466ad8454da895a1932cbebbbd31c8bd08b79:1
value 30000000
address 15a6Pytbt3VQueDRdmh5Z5xxTKK3sGdCFN
value 12274909
address 17inpugM7PejycQfsZLUFN64EbT7RWArT1